Hollywood star and professional wrestler John Cena has achieved a major milestone in his 23-year WWE career, winning the Intercontinental Championship for the first time.
Cena secured the title by defeating Dominik Mysterio at WWE Raw, completing his WWE Grand Slam, a rare feat in professional wrestling. To achieve a Grand Slam, a wrestler must hold at least one United States Championship, Tag Team Championship, Intercontinental Championship, and WWE Championship over their career.
With this victory, Cena, a 17-time WWE Champion, becomes the 25th wrestler in WWE history to complete the Grand Slam. Previous Grand Slam winners include wrestling legends such as Shawn Michaels, Triple H, Roman Reigns, and Seth Rollins.
